“Democrats who worried about President Biden’s re-election prospects even before his uneven debate Thursday had been pointing to a bright spot in this year’s campaign: The party’s Senate candidates, and some vulnerable House candidates, generally poll better than the weakened president,” the Wall Street Journal reports. “Now, those Democratic candidates and their aides are trying to sort through whether Biden’s halting performance and sometimes dazed appearance have sapped the party’s goals of retaining the Senate and flipping the House.
